A graphene oxide-TiO2 composite (GO-TiO2) has been synthesized and characterized using FT-IR, FT-Raman, XRD, XPS, FESEM, EDX, TEM and N-2 adsorption-desorption. GO-TiO2 has been found to be a highly efficient and recyclable heterogeneous catalyst for the synthesis of pyrazoles and pyridines in aqueous medium at room temperature.
